Table 4 Laboratory data of familial Mediterranean fever patients and controls
Characteristic
Attack (n = 40)
Attack-Free (n = 40)
Controls (n = 40)
P1
P2
P3
TLC (× 10³/μL)9.91 ± 1.788.67 ± 1.016.84 ± 1.26< 0.001a< 0.001a0.009a
ESR 1st hour (mm)50.27 ± 18.9810.95 ± 6.212.35 ± 1.36< 0.001a< 0.001a< 0.001a
ESR 2nd hour (mm)75.03 ± 14.7933.25 ± 6.2917.58 ± 3.09< 0.001a< 0.001a< 0.001a
CRP (mg/L)60.93 ± 17.9826.13 ± 6.5410.07 ± 1.82< 0.001a< 0.001a< 0.001a
Amyloid A (mg/L)114.95 ± 82.276.73 ± 1.574.25 ± 1.10< 0.001a< 0.001a< 0.001a
Resistin (ng/mL)28.57 ± 6.9417.33 ± 3.0511.16 ± 5.24< 0.001a< 0.001a< 0.001a
Fibrinogen (mg/dL)630.55 ± 124.44302.77 ± 74.18234.38 ± 99.73< 0.001a< 0.001a0.042a
